Ileana's bareback scene and lip-lock made it
to the headlines. But now, according to a
report in a leading tabloid, director Milan
Lutharia has decided to chop off all the
intimate scenes between the two.
A source told the tabloid, "The scene
between Ileana and Ajay, if left as is, lasts for
10 minutes. It's aesthetically shot and is
crucial to the film's plot. But Milan decided to
shorten it, trimming the kisses and bareback
shots. He didn't want to attract the wrath of
the Censors. The film is all-out commercial
and he wants it to get a U/A certificate. The
scene would have resulted in an A
certificate."
"Milan doesn't want to face controversy
ahead of release," added the source. In an
interview recently, when Milan Luthria was
asked about the comparison that might
happen between Baadshaho and Once
Upon A Time in Mumbaai, he said, "Even if
people feel the hangover of Once Upon A
Time in Mumbaai looking at Baadshaho it's
ok. I don't fear that comparison (referring to
story and recreating the success of the film)
as both the stories are completely different."
He added, "One was a gangster film about
the rise and fall of two gangsters, this
Baadshaho is an action drama film about
the six main characters and the heist that
takes place against the backdrop of 1975
Emergency period."
Milan further revealed, "It was special to
work with Ajay and Emraan again, who
transformed themselves for the film. Also, it
was special working with Vidyut Jammwal,
Ileana D'Cruz, Esha Gupta and Sanjay Mishra.
We have designed special looks for each of
them."
